How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Description

    The Environmental Manager is responsible for developing and supporting the implementation of environmental plans to support the environmental strategy, ensuring compliance with relevant legislation and driving continuous improvement in environmental performance. This role plays a critical part in shaping the organisations long-term environmental leadership within the utilities sector. 

    Key Responsibilities

    Develop and implement environmental strategies, policies and action plans that sup-port corporate objectives and promote continuous improvement

    Ensure full compliance with UK, EU and International environmental legislation, regulations and best practice. 

    Maintain up to date knowledge of emerging legislative changes, industry trends and environmental risks. 

    Develop, implement and continually improve Environmental Management Systems to maintain ISO14001 certification. 

    Coordinate initiatives for: Streetworks UK, pollution control, waste management, recycling, environmental health, conservation, biodiversity and renewable energy.

    Audit, analyse and report environmental performance to senior management, regulatory bodies and external stakeholders (where required).

    Lead the preparation and publication of environmental reports, assuming overall responsibility for content and quality.

    Support the business with the creation of Environmental Permits. 

    Conduct environmental impact assessments, risk reviews and cost analyses to identify opportunities to reduce environmental impact and financial exposure.

    Liaise with regulatory authorities, local authorities, public bodies and environmental agencies.

    Manage relationships with senior leaders and internal colleagues, ensuring transparency and alignment on environmental priorities.

    Promote environmental awareness and sustainability across all organisational levels, fostering a culture of responsibility.

    Participate in environmental education programmes, industry forums and research initiatives to strengthen organisational capabilities and reputation.

    Experience and Qualifications

    Essential
    Relevant environmental or sustainability degree or equivalent professional qualification (or evidence of working towards).

    Membership of a recognised professional body (e.g., IEMA, CIWEM) (or evidence of working towards).

    5 years experience working in Senior Environmental with demonstratable ability to provide advice on legislative change and implementing systems to meet such changes. 

    Strong knowledge of UK, EU and international environmental regulations and compliance frameworks.

    Demonstrable experience in environmental management within a large, complex organisation 

    Expertise in developing and implementing environmental management systems (e.g., ISO 14001) and integrated systems.

    Competent in environmental risk assessment, impact assessments (EIA) and ecological constraints.

    Proven ability to lead cross-functional improvement initiatives.

    Strong analytical, auditing and reporting skills.

    Excellent communication, influencing and stakeholder engagement capabilities.

    Good computer skills at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int Teams Tools

    Understand Data and act upon non-compliant issues

    Able to liaise with client and customer stakeholders – both internal and external

    Strong written and verbal communication and people skills

    Full driving licence

    Desirable
    Experience of working in utilities, waste management, infrastructure or industrial sec-tors.

    Understanding of Streetworks UK Requirements and Waste Management Regulations

    Knowledge of carbon management, net zero and sustainability

    Experience liaising with regulatory authorities, local authorities, public bodies and environmental agencies.
